随着移动互联网的快速发展,小程序作为一种轻量级应用,凭借其便捷性、易用性等特点迅速普及。然而,小程序即时通讯功能在方便用户沟通的同时,也带来了安全隐患,尤其是用户信息隐私保护问题。本文将从小程序即时通讯的安全性入手,探讨如何保障用户信息隐私。
一、小程序即时通讯存在的安全隐患
1. 数据传输安全
小程序即时通讯功能需要通过网络传输用户数据,而数据在传输过程中可能会遭受黑客攻击、窃取等风险。以下是一些常见的数据传输安全问题:
(1)数据未加密:部分小程序开发者没有对数据进行加密处理,导致数据在传输过程中容易被窃取。
(2)中间人攻击:黑客通过截获用户与小程序服务器之间的通信,篡改数据内容,甚至窃取用户隐私。
(3)SQL注入:攻击者通过构造恶意SQL语句,入侵小程序数据库,获取用户信息。
2. 用户信息泄露
小程序即时通讯功能需要收集用户个人信息,如手机号码、身份证号、家庭住址等。以下是一些用户信息泄露的风险:
(1)开发者泄露:开发者可能因为个人原因或恶意行为,将用户信息泄露给第三方。
(2)服务器安全漏洞:服务器存在安全漏洞,导致用户信息被非法获取。
(3)第三方应用获取:用户在使用第三方应用时,可能授权该应用获取其个人信息,进而导致信息泄露。
二、保障用户信息隐私的措施
1. 数据传输加密
(1)使用HTTPS协议:小程序应采用HTTPS协议进行数据传输,确保数据在传输过程中的安全。
(2)数据加密存储:对用户数据进行加密存储,防止数据泄露。
2. 严格限制用户权限
(1)最小权限原则:开发者应遵循最小权限原则,只获取用户必要的个人信息。
(2)权限申请透明:在获取用户权限时,应明确告知用户所需权限及用途。
3. 服务器安全防护
(1)定期更新系统:及时更新服务器操作系统、数据库等软件,修复安全漏洞。
(2)防火墙设置:设置防火墙,防止非法访问。
(3)入侵检测系统:部署入侵检测系统,及时发现并阻止攻击行为。
4. 加强开发者管理
(1)加强开发者培训:提高开发者对信息安全、用户隐私保护的认识。
(2)严格审核开发者资质:对开发者进行严格审核,确保其具备信息安全意识。
5. 用户隐私保护政策
(1)明确隐私保护政策:制定完善的隐私保护政策,明确用户信息收集、使用、存储、删除等方面的规定。
(2)及时更新政策:根据法律法规和实际情况,及时更新隐私保护政策。
三、结论
小程序即时通讯在方便用户沟通的同时,也带来了安全隐患。为保障用户信息隐私,开发者应从数据传输安全、用户信息泄露等方面入手,采取有效措施加强安全防护。同时,加强用户隐私保护政策宣传,提高用户安全意识,共同营造安全、健康的网络环境。